IPL 2026: Aquib Nabi Misses Out As DC Elect To Bowl Against SRH
Sunrisers Hyderabad made a single change as Auqib Nabi made way for Nitish Rana, while Ishan Kishan noted that the pitch looks slower than in the previous games. The side has also brought in Harsh Dubey and Dilshan Madushanka, replacing Praful Hinge and possibly Liam Livingstone as they adjust their combination for the conditions.
Delhi Capitals captain Axar Patel said, "I am getting lucky in terms of the toss, but had we won all the games as well, then it would have been ideal. We are going to bowl first.”
